Jump to content

User:Greatder/Valknut (software)

From Wikipedia, the free encyclopedia
Valknut
Valknut in KDE
Valknut
Developer(s) Mathias Küster, Edward Sheldrake
Stable release 0.3.23 (Qt3), 0.4.9 (Qt4) / 10 February 2009; 12 years ago
Written in C++
Operating system Linux, FreeBSD, Mac OS X, Microsoft Windows, OS/2 resp. eComStation
Type Peer-to-peer (P2P)
License GPL
Website wxdcgui.sourceforge.net
  • Free and open-source software portal

Valknut is a client program for peer-to-peer file sharing that uses the Direct Connect protocol. It is compatible with other DC clients, such as the original DC from Neomodus, DC++ and derivatives. Valknut also interoperates with all common DC hub software.[1][2][3][4]

Valknut was originally written by Mathias Küster and is licensed under the terms of the GNU General Public License (GPL). It is written in C++ and uses the cross-platform Qt library for its GUI. Valknut compiles and runs on Linux, FreeBSD, Mac OS X, Microsoft Windows, and OS/2 - eComStation.

Originally, Valknut was called DCGUI, which was similar to the name of another Linux DC client. It was then renamed to dcgui-qt to avoid confusion. However, trademark problems relating to the use of 'Qt' in the name forced another name change, to Valknut.

Following the release of Valknut 0.3.7, Mathias Küster stopped working on Valknut. Edward Sheldrake then moved (forked?) the code into the wxDCGUI project, where work is underway[when?] to add additional features, as well as to port Valknut's Qt3 user interface to Qt4 and eventually to wxWidgets. In May 2008 the first Qt4 version was released.[citation needed]

During startup, the graphics of the splash screen show a Valknut.

EiskaltDC is a disconnected fork of Valknut.

EiskaltDC++ [ru] is a fork of DC++ (only kernel, without GUI) but programmed by the same authors. Packages with EiskaltDC++ have been available for example on Fedora, OpenSUSE or Debian.

There are various graphical interfaces available, using GTK+ version 2 and 3 and Qt version 4 and 5 for the GUI widgets. There also is daemon that is remote controllable via JSON-RPC by CLI on Perl and WebUI on JavaScript.

References

[edit]
  1. Softonic Review: Valknut Review
  2. https://software.opensuse.org/package/eiskaltdcpp
  3. ^ https://packages.debian.org/sid/eiskaltdcpp
  4. ^ https://packages.debian.org/sid/eiskaltdcpp-daemon
  5. Original Source: Valknut (ehemals DCGUI) - Client für Direct-Connect P2P
  6. wxdcgui page: The Valknut Project
  7. 2003 CVE allowing non-permitted file to be accessed - Valknut 0.3.22 / 0.4.8 [LWN.net], https://cve.mitre.org/cgi-bin/cvename.cgi?name=CVE-2003-0076
  8. Releases:
    1. Arch: AUR (en) - valknut,
    2. Slackware: valknut-0.4.9-x86_64-2_slonly.txz Slackware 14.2 Download,
    3. Mint: https://community.linuxmint.com/software/view/valknut
    4. Fedora: https://src.fedoraproject.org/search?type=projects&direct=1&term=rpms%2Fvalknut
    5. Linux Apps: Valknut - linux-apps.com
    6. Gentoo removal commit: 1
    7. Ubuntu: https://launchpad.net/ubuntu/xenial/+source/valknut
  9. Manual: Valknut Manual

See Also

[edit]
  • Valknut on SourceForge.net
  • Mac OS X binary releases
  • EiskaltDC on SourceForge.net - (fork Valknut)
  • EiskaltDC++ on SourceForge.net - EiskaltDC++ (completely new client from EiskaltDC developers)

Section/Category:Peer-to-peer file sharing

Categories:

  • Direct Connect network
  • Free file sharing software
  • Free software programmed in C++
  • File sharing software that uses Qt
  • DC clients for Linux
  1. ^ "valknut - almost DEAD". www.pling.com. Retrieved 2022-05-22.
  2. ^ "Valknut (software)". Academic Dictionaries and Encyclopedias. Retrieved 2022-05-22.
  3. ^ "Mac OS version".
  4. ^ Valknut (Software). Betascript Publishing. 2010. ISBN 9786131263279.